At least Grant Holt could score goals - his strike-rate for Norwich was about 70 in 160 games

Alan Smith never managed 50 goals in his career
Hard to compare Holt to Smith in goal scoring terms as Holt has played his career as a striker and Smith hasnt.
Alan Smith spent big chunks of his career being moved around. At Leeds he was initially a striker but because of his versatility he got pushed from one position to another. Same deal with us to a certain extent. He scored goals when he was allowed to play as a striker but I would bet he only got to play that position for about 1/4th of his time at Leeds and with us. I think he scored about 70 goals in his career. Not really a bad return for a player who spent 3/4 of his career in midfield or doing utility jobs despite the fact everyone thinks he spent his career playing as a striker.
